QUETTA: Two persons were injured on Thursday when militants hurled a hand grenade at the election office of Pakistan Peoples Party in Noshki area of Balochistan, police said.

The motorcycle-riding-attackers managed to escape after the incident.

Police said the blast damaged a portion of the election office as well and that the injured were shifted to Civil Hospital Noshki for medical treatment.

Police and levies personnel reached the spot as investigations into the attack went underway.

There was no claim of responsibility over the incident.
